Transaction 2f8077db81f0493cd0ceffa97ae4ef576d964604ab95e55ea87569a80d40deff
1 Input
1 Output
-
2f8077db81f0493cd0ceffa97ae4ef576d964604ab95e55ea87569a80d40deff:0
- value
- 2659755
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0cc5126022a0a585eebeb4e3d2c55d96cb02d12
- address
- bc1qurx9zfsz9g99shhtad8r6tz4m9ktqtgjuaq6x0